Переполнение памяти при редактировании окна

Clarion, Clarion 7

Модератор: Дед Пахом

Правила форума
При написании вопроса или обсуждении проблемы, не забывайте указывать версию Clarion который Вы используете.
А так же пользуйтесь спец. тегами при вставке исходников!!!
Аватара пользователя
Губин Игорь
Шубуршун
Сообщения: 2584
Зарегистрирован: 16 Сентябрь 2005, 16:35
Откуда: Москва
Благодарил (а): 3 раза
Поблагодарили: 26 раз

Re: Переполнение памяти при редактировании окна

Сообщение Губин Игорь »

НИФИГА! У меня нет переполнения! :P

Кстати, когда-то (ещё до деревянного интерфейса) у меня была похожая ситуация. Я её решал "через одно место" делая в одной процедуре кучу окон и открывая/закрывая их по необходимости. Решение через задницу, но тогда ничего получше не нашлось.
Это я только кажусь дураком! На самом деле я полный идиот!
slav95211
Новичок
Сообщения: 8
Зарегистрирован: 10 Август 2012, 15:27

Re: Переполнение памяти при редактировании окна

Сообщение slav95211 »

Сокращение длины меток большого преимущества не дает, как выяснилось. При сокращении длины меток где-то в три раза удалось добавить группу, поле ввода, две кнопки и шесть радио-кнопок. Так что сокращение длины имен практически исчерпано. Замена чеков на List напрашивается, но не всегда выручает, т.к. часто чек относится к определенному параметру и группировать его с другими нелогично. Вопрос такой. У нас есть версия Clarion 7.3.7900 Обеспечит ли переход на эту версию решение проблемы? Спасибо.
Аватара пользователя
Губин Игорь
Шубуршун
Сообщения: 2584
Зарегистрирован: 16 Сентябрь 2005, 16:35
Откуда: Москва
Благодарил (а): 3 раза
Поблагодарили: 26 раз

Re: Переполнение памяти при редактировании окна

Сообщение Губин Игорь »

Боюсь, что без кардинальной переработки идеи окна ничего не получится. Принцип "вывалим всё сразу и на один экран" явно не оптимален. Подумайте над применением From, Create или нескольких окон (если уж вы так неравнодушны к текущему дизайну)
Это я только кажусь дураком! На самом деле я полный идиот!
Shur
Ветеран
Сообщения: 384
Зарегистрирован: 02 Июль 2011, 18:49

Re: Переполнение памяти при редактировании окна

Сообщение Shur »

slav95211 писал(а):У нас есть версия Clarion 7.3.7900 Обеспечит ли переход на эту версию решение проблемы?
Однозначно "да". Это проверено. С7, С8, С9 -- в данном случае безразлично.
32-битная версия позволяет вам иметь структуру WINDOW размером до 4 Гб. Сколько чеков ещё можно наплодить!
Аватара пользователя
Admin
Администратор
Сообщения: 4010
Зарегистрирован: 05 Июль 2005, 15:59
Откуда: Хабаровск
Благодарил (а): 53 раза
Поблагодарили: 33 раза
Контактная информация:

Re: Переполнение памяти при редактировании окна

Сообщение Admin »

slav95211 писал(а):Сокращение длины меток большого преимущества не дает, как выяснилось. При сокращении длины меток где-то в три раза удалось добавить группу, поле ввода, две кнопки и шесть радио-кнопок. Так что сокращение длины имен практически исчерпано. Замена чеков на List напрашивается, но не всегда выручает, т.к. часто чек относится к определенному параметру и группировать его с другими нелогично. Вопрос такой. У нас есть версия Clarion 7.3.7900 Обеспечит ли переход на эту версию решение проблемы? Спасибо.
Второй раз попрошу. Если не секретная информация, можно ли здесь выложить код вашего окна?
Рай совершает ошибки ничуть не реже чем ад. Просто у него хорошая пресса
slav95211
Новичок
Сообщения: 8
Зарегистрирован: 10 Август 2012, 15:27

Re: Переполнение памяти при редактировании окна

Сообщение slav95211 »

Направляю текст окна
Вложения
win_psk.clw
(62.46 КБ) 356 скачиваний
Shur
Ветеран
Сообщения: 384
Зарегистрирован: 02 Июль 2011, 18:49

Re: Переполнение памяти при редактировании окна

Сообщение Shur »

IMHO Большую экономию дало бы использование для контролов фонта по умолчанию, задаваемого в заголовке окна.
И в качестве фейка -- сэкономить ещё можно на иконках, расположив их в основной папке, тогда можно убрать путь к папке.
Аватара пользователя
Admin
Администратор
Сообщения: 4010
Зарегистрирован: 05 Июль 2005, 15:59
Откуда: Хабаровск
Благодарил (а): 53 раза
Поблагодарили: 33 раза
Контактная информация:

Re: Переполнение памяти при редактировании окна

Сообщение Admin »

Shur писал(а):И в качестве фейка
Наверное имелось в виду "И в качестве трикса"
Рай совершает ошибки ничуть не реже чем ад. Просто у него хорошая пресса
Ответить